The HCI Bibliography (http://hcibib.org),
hosted for over a decade by ACM SIGCHI,
has recently been updated with thousands of records,
bringing the total to over 48,000.
Many new records are for previously uncovered conferences:
* AVI: Advanced Visual Interfaces (1994-)
* CHINZ: CHI New Zealand (2205-)
* DocEng: Document Engineering (2001-)
* ETRA: Eye Tracking Research & Applications (1999-)
* Future Play (2007-)
* ICMI: International Conference on Multimodal Interfaces (2002-)
* Mobile HCI (2004-)
* SoftVis: Software Visualization (2003-)
* TEI: Tangible and Embedded Interaction (2007-)
* VRST: Virtual Reality Software and Technology (1997-)
as well as some conferences with non-English content:
* CLIHC: Latin American HCI (2003-)
* IHM: Interaction Homme-Machine (2002-)
* UbiMob: French Ubiquity Mobility (2004-)
as well as the historical coverage of:
* GI: Graphics Interface (1969-)

The HCI Bibliography is a free-access bibliography on human-computer
interaction with over 48,000 records, mostly with abstracts and links
to full text. The HCIBib search service has performed over 4.7 million
searches since 1 December 2006, serving thousands of users worldwide,
who have also displayed 1.8 million interactive tables of contents of
conference proceedings and journal volumes.
